Transit and Railroad Police Salary in Hawaii

$45,249 $146,847
10th pct Median: $85,376 90th pct
Percentile Annual Salary
10th (Entry Level)$45,249
25th Percentile$61,471
50th (Median)$85,376
75th Percentile$117,819
90th (Top Earners)$146,847
Source: U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ics OEWS, May 2024

Cost of Living Adjusted Salary

The Hawaii median salary of $85,376 for Transit and Railroad Police has the purchasing power of approximately $44,513 in Missouri (the COL baseline state with index 100).

Hawaii's higher cost of living (COL index: 191.8) reduces the real purchasing power of wages compared to lower-cost states.

COL data: MERIC 2024 State Cost of Living Index. Missouri = 100 baseline.

Frequently Asked Questions

How much do Transit and Railroad Police make in Hawaii?
Transit and Railroad Police in Hawaii earn a median annual salary of $85,376 per year ($41.05/hr) according to BLS OEWS data (May 2024). This is above the national median of $74,240.
Is Hawaii a good state for Transit and Railroad Police?
Hawaii pays above the national average for transit and railroad police, making it a competitive market for this occupation. Cost of living in Hawaii is higher average (COL index: 191.8).
What is the cost-of-living adjusted salary for Transit and Railroad Police in Hawaii?
After adjusting for cost of living (COL index: 191.8 vs. Missouri baseline of 100), the $85,376 salary in Hawaii has the purchasing power of approximately $44,513 in Missouri. Higher living costs in Hawaii reduce real purchasing power.
